Predicting Premium Proneness

A premium is a free gift offered to consumers when they purchase a product, and marketers in many product categories are using them as a sales promotional tool.

INTRODUCTION

Sales promotion represents an important component of the marketing communications mix. Sales promotion tools are useful at all stages of the product life cycle, from encouraging trial to inducing brand switching to maintaining loyalty.
